Description | A. The Shawnee County Jail Reroof project consists of the original part of the ADC with a new EPDM roof and is located at 501 SE 8th Ave.in Topeka, KS. This will include the installation of a standing seam metal roof over an existing skylight style roof. This project will includereplacement of all 24 gauge cap metal on all walls even those that do not have roofing connected to them. The project consists of installing Carlisle's Sure-Seal EPDM Adhered Roofing System or approved alternate system as outlined below: Tear off all existing roofing material, rigid insulation, gypsum board, cap metal, flashing and edge metal. Check condition of existing metal/concrete deck for suitability. Install fully adhered EPDM roofing system over cover board over tapered polyisocyanurate insulation. Existing roof hatches and skylights to remain. Flash as required for warranty. Existing lightning protection to be reinstalled as-is at completion of project. Certification not required. Gypsum substrate board does not need to be replaced. Tapered ISO to match existing height at drains and to taper out from drains with 1/8" slope. Standing seam roof shall be fashioned to provide a waterproof barrier over old skylight and provide positive drainage. A gutter/downspout system shall also be installed to keep snow/ice from sliding down to sidewalk below. Metal shall be 24 gauge and match color to the capmetal being installed in other areas. C.
